Making a small URL provider is a fascinating job that consists of various aspects of software package improvement, like World wide web improvement, database administration, and API style and design. This is a detailed overview of The subject, by using a center on the essential components, difficulties, and greatest procedures associated with creating a URL shortener.

1. Introduction to URL Shortening
URL shortening is a method on the Internet during which an extended URL can be converted into a shorter, much more manageable type. This shortened URL redirects to the original extended URL when visited. Services like Bitly and TinyURL are very well-known examples of URL shorteners. The necessity for URL shortening arose with the arrival of social networking platforms like Twitter, in which character limitations for posts produced it difficult to share very long URLs.

Outside of social media, URL shorteners are beneficial in advertising strategies, email messages, and printed media where extensive URLs might be cumbersome.

2. Main Factors of a URL Shortener
A URL shortener commonly includes the next factors:

Net Interface: Here is the entrance-stop aspect in which consumers can enter their long URLs and obtain shortened variations. It can be an easy variety on a Web content.
Database: A database is important to store the mapping involving the first lengthy URL as well as shortened Edition. Databases like MySQL, PostgreSQL, or NoSQL possibilities like MongoDB can be used.
Redirection Logic: This can be the backend logic that takes the short URL and redirects the consumer to the corresponding lengthy URL. This logic is frequently executed in the web server or an software layer.
API: Numerous URL shorteners supply an API to make sure that third-get together apps can programmatically shorten URLs and retrieve the first prolonged URLs.
3. Developing the URL Shortening Algorithm
The crux of the URL shortener lies in its algorithm for changing a protracted URL into a brief one particular. Several solutions could be used, including:

Hashing: The prolonged URL may be hashed into a set-sizing string, which serves since the shorter URL. Nonetheless, hash collisions (distinctive URLs resulting in precisely the same hash) need to be managed.
Base62 Encoding: A person widespread solution is to use Base62 encoding (which takes advantage of sixty two characters: 0-nine, A-Z, in addition to a-z) on an integer ID. The ID corresponds towards the entry inside the databases. This method ensures that the short URL is as brief as you can.
Random String Era: A different tactic will be to deliver a random string of a set size (e.g., six people) and Test if it’s now in use in the database. If not, it’s assigned to your lengthy URL.
four. Database Management
The database schema for a URL shortener is usually straightforward, with two Most important fields:

ID: A unique identifier for every URL entry.
Long URL: The original URL that should be shortened.
Shorter URL/Slug: The small Model from the URL, typically stored as a novel string.
In addition to these, you might like to retail outlet metadata like the generation date, expiration date, and the volume of occasions the limited URL has actually been accessed.

five. Handling Redirection
Redirection can be a crucial Section of the URL shortener's Procedure. Any time a person clicks on a brief URL, the company needs to quickly retrieve the original URL in the database and redirect the user employing an HTTP 301 (everlasting redirect) or 302 (momentary redirect) position code.

Performance is vital here, as the method should be virtually instantaneous. Techniques like database indexing and caching (e.g., applying Redis or Memcached) may be utilized to hurry up the retrieval process.

6. Protection Concerns
Safety is an important concern in URL shorteners:

Malicious URLs: A URL shortener might be abused to distribute destructive hyperlinks. Applying URL validation, blacklisting, or integrating with 3rd-party security providers to examine URLs in advance of shortening them can mitigate this risk.
Spam Prevention: Charge limiting and CAPTCHA can avert abuse by spammers endeavoring to generate A large number of quick URLs.
7. Scalability
Since the URL shortener grows, it might require to manage a lot of URLs and redirect requests. This demands a scalable architecture, quite possibly involving load balancers, dispersed databases, and microservices.

Load Balancing: Distribute targeted visitors throughout many servers to manage substantial masses.
Distributed Databases: Use databases that will scale horizontally, like Cassandra or MongoDB.
Microservices: Separate concerns like URL shortening, analytics, and redirection into different services to further improve scalability and maintainability.
eight. Analytics
URL shorteners usually supply analytics to track how frequently a short URL is clicked, exactly where the visitors is coming from, and other practical metrics. This involves logging Every single redirect and possibly integrating with analytics platforms.

nine. Conclusion
Creating a URL shortener entails a mixture of frontend and backend growth, database administration, and attention to stability and scalability. Even though it may appear to be a simple assistance, creating a strong, productive, and protected URL shortener presents quite a few issues and requires watchful planning and execution. Irrespective of whether you’re generating it for private use, inner corporation resources, or for a public provider, understanding the underlying rules and best procedures is important for success.
